The beginning
By Kilian built its identity on names that function as one-liners, Good Girl Gone Bad, Voulez-vous coucher avec Moi. The brand treats fragrance titles as declarations, not just labels. I Never Make The Same Mistake Twice, Unless They're Crazy Hot is the logical extension of that philosophy: a name that earns a double-take, paired with a composition that doesn't apologize for what it is. Perfumer Calice Becker worked with a fruity-floral structure, blackcurrant, mandarin, pear opening into plum and rose absolute, grounded by vanilla and sandalwood, that delivers exactly what the name promises.
The tension here is deliberate: a name that suggests bravado, a scent that suggests warmth. The blackcurrant and citrus top notes arrive bright and confident, but they don't stay. They give way to a heart of plum and rose absolute that feels plush and romantic rather than confrontational. The patchouli in the heart adds an earthy counterweight, a reminder that this fragrance isn't trying to be delicate. By the time the vanilla and sandalwood arrive in the base, the sweetness has been earned. It's not naive. It's confident.
The evolution
The opening arrives fast, blackcurrant and mandarin orange hit together, tart and electric. Pink pepper flickers at the edges, keeping the citrus from being too sharp. Pear appears softly, rounding everything out before the heart takes over. Within thirty minutes, the top notes begin their exit. The plum and rose absolute emerge at the center, bringing a jammy sweetness that feels almost plush. Patchouli grounds the florals with an earthy undertone that prevents the heart from floating entirely into the abstract. This is where the fragrance shifts from bright to warm. The drydown is where the work happens. Vanilla and sandalwood arrive together, creating a creamy, slightly woody base that lingers close to the skin. On most skin types, this phase holds for six to eight hours, present without overwhelming. The sillage stays moderate throughout, which means the fragrance is never filling a room, but someone standing beside you will notice it before you do.
